Learn How to Spot Mate in 1: Kingside Attack
This puzzle is a classic middlegame mating net built around king safety. White’s pieces are already aimed at the enemy king, and the position contains a direct tactical finish rather than a long strategic plan. The key idea is that the king’s shelter has been weakened enough that one forcing move ends the game immediately. In practical play, these are the positions where calculation matters less than pattern recognition: if the king is boxed in and the attacking pieces are coordinated, a checkmate may be available right away.
